At What Temperature Does Olive Oil Solidify?

At what temperature does olive oil solidify? The answer is that it begins to solidify in the mid 40s Fahrenheit, when natural wax particles precipitate and cloud the oil. What Fish Tastes like Lobster?

If you’re wondering what fish tastes like lobster, monkfish is the closest match. Its firm, snowy fillets hold up to heat and develop a sweet bite when finished with butter, garlic, and citrus, giving you a lobster-like impression in a home kitchen.
